He'd been teaching now for almost a month and he was enjoying it immensely. His students were great - he had three classes that he lectured in on Monday, Wednesday and Friday and the good thing was, he was typically done by one in the afternoon. He'd spend two more hours in his office in case the students had questions and so that he could put grades into the computer when necessary.
It was just such an afternoon and he was waiting for Methos to come pick him up for the day - they were going out to dinner that night - when a knock at his door got his attention.
"Come in," he called out in Spanish. The door opened to reveal one of his students, a young American named Brian who was probably twenty years old if that. Brian smiled as he came in and closed the door. "What can I help you with, Brian?" Daniel continued in English.
"Well, I had some questions about your lecture on World War One," he said quietly as he sat down in front of Daniel's desk. Daniel nodded and leaned back in his chair.
"What kind of questions?"
"Well, more like observations, really," Brian said with a smile. What his professor didn't know was that Brian had fought in the first world war - for America - and then again in World War II and some of the things Daniel had spoken of, Brian either didn't remember happening or he remembered them a different way. Plus, it gave him a chance to spend time with the good looking man. Of course, Brian had seen the wedding band on Daniel's finger but that had never stopped Brian before...
